A Phase II Trial Evaluating WNT974 in Patients With Metastatic Head and Neck Squamous Cell Carcinoma

NCT02649530 · Status: WITHDRAWN · Phase: PHASE2 · Type: INTERVENTIONAL

Last updated 2016-09-30

No results posted yet for this study

Summary

Given that up-regulation of the Wnt pathway has been identified as having a significant role in carcinogenesis in advanced head and neck squamous cell carcinoma, the investigator believes that inhibition of Porcupine via WNT974 will result in tumor control hence improvement in disease free and overall survival in these patients with a tolerable toxicity profile. As suggested by pre-clinical models, patients with a tumor harboring a Notch receptor (any of the four) loss of function mutation may have a greater response rate to treatment with WNT974. The investigator aims to address this question by administration of single agent WNT974 and following response radiologically along with close clinical follow up to monitor toxicities.
